#336f0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#336f0e is composed of 20% red, 43.5%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 97.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 24.5%. #336f0e color hex could be obtained by blending #66de1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#336f0e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#336f0e has RGB values of R:51, G:111,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 3370766.

Shades and Tints of #336f0e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030601 is the darkest color, while #f8f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#336f0e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3f3e is the less saturated color, while #317904 is the most saturated one.
